This is one of Cedar Rapids/Marion's hidden treasures! I've lived in Cedar Rapids for close to…read moreeight years and had never heard of this place until a friend of mine asked if I wanted to see Little Women with her last weekend. The seating in the theater consists of couches, love seats, big comfy chairs and some table/chair combos making it feel like you're watching the play from your living room. They also have a small concession area in the lobby where you can purchase drinks (non alcoholic, beer and wine) and snacks to enjoy while watching the show. It's community theater so you need to keep in mind that a lot of the actors are still developing their craft and with this performance in particular there were several children, but overall I really enjoyed the performances. One of the coolest things about Giving Tree though is that for every production they put on, the actors decide on a charity and they donate a portion of the proceeds to that charity--hence the name Giving Tree Theater.
